Why not keep them separated until she is receptive?
My female got a bit chewed up (*I just happen to post apic of here here: http://www.monsterfishkeepers.com/forums/showthread.php?577913-P-loisellie-close-up/page3
-when she was like that. Mind you this happened because the male went over the divider (there was about a half inch room) -afterwards I used a flat rock to fill in that gap. Kept them apart about another week or two. When I saw her trying to get through the divider, reciprocating the male's rapid up and down swimming,, and her belly fat with eggs.. I removed the divider,, No problems since/.
